We traveled on southerly aspects to 12,400 feet and did not observe signs of instability. The facets above the meltdown crust were not present on this particular feature, but this weak layer appears to be hit or miss across the landscape. We avoided wind-drifted features and favored lightly scoured slopes where recent storm totals ranged from 12 to 16 inches. Snow surfaces on south slightly moistened today, and when the sun makes a full return wet loose avalanche problems will return.
A few small undocumented avalanches for the storm around 4/1. We triggered two very small, moist loose avalanches on steep sunny features.Weather

Clear skies began to cloud up around 11 am. Mostly cloudy skies until we left the area around 2 pm. Storm totals near and above treeline are around 14 to 16 inches above the meltdown crust from last week. We did not travel through well-drifted terrain but you can expect to encounter deeper totals on leeward features.
Snowpack
We dug a handful of test profiles on south-to-southwest features near and above treeline with no results on the meltdown crust. A few pits showed non-propagating results within the storm snow, but no major concerns were found. The places in this terrain we investigated lacked facets above the meltdown crust. The snow surface moistened from the morning sun, but cloud cover arrived before loose avalanche activity became an issue.
We dug a hole on a below treeline slope facing west to northwest and found meltwater drained through the entire snowpack during last week's warmup. We looked for facets at the meltdown interface and found some faceting but not as worrisome as other locations.
